Add to basketFirst edition, first printing, with full number line to copyright page, flat signed to front endpaper. Rare example of a signed first edition of one of Butler's works. Famous for championing third wave feminism, she now moves through many genres of philosophy in her works. Book is fine, jacket is fine minus with hints of rubbing at top edge. Squat octavo, black boards with blue cloth spine, 168 pages, pictorial jacket. Satisfaction guaranteed. Additional photos always available on request. Shipped in a fitted, padded box.
